A-Spire Players is bringing a fast-paced, family-friendly Greek mythology comedy to Gimli’s historic theatre, with tickets now on sale for the August 14-16 run of “The Greek Mythology Olympiaganza.”

The show, written by award-winning playwright Don Zolidis, uses audience participation, cross-dressing, and what producers call “general theatrical insanity” to cover the entirety of Greek mythology in one evening. It is directed by Sky Militere and stage managed by Ryan Janz.
The production runs at the A-Spire Theatre, located at 76 2nd Avenue in Gimli, a heritage church building that now serves as the company’s home. The company was founded by Brian Richardson in 1992, and for over three decades, A-Spire Players has brought live theatre to Gimli and the surrounding Interlake region.
The community theatre group has received support from the RM of Gimli and the Westshore Community Foundation, a local philanthropic organization that has granted over $1,180,000 since 1998 to support initiatives across the area.
Cast members include Mavis Viola Davies, Philip Paley, Rox Picton, Hunter Shupenia, Ava Valentim, Nikita Maud, Parker McElroy, Elyse Alphonso-Thorassie, Arshdeep Sidhu, Phil Picton, and Mia Hoilett.
